About a week ago I noticed plaster in my skimmer pot. I examined the pool bottom and found an area of breakdown I had not noticed before. It is about 4 inches across.

The pool was replastered in May 2015.

Looking for siggestions and answers. Can such damage be repaired without risking further damage? Are DIY pool plaster repair kits worthwhile? With this being the 2nd layer of plaster, is it necessary to take it off before replastering again?

I also am looking at options to refinish the pool with flake or quartz and polyaspartic. We did the deck with flake and poly a couple years ago. These options seem about the same as a replastering.
